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_001377440.1(LRP2BP):āc.259G>Cā(p.Glu87Gln) variant causes a missense change. The variant allele was found at a frequency of 0.0000155 in 1,611,816 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Oct 09, 2024 | The c.259G>C (p.E87Q) alteration is located in exon 3 (coding exon 3) of the LRP2BP gene. This alteration results from a G to C substitution at nucleotide position 259, causing the glutamic acid (E) at amino acid position 87 to be replaced by a glutamine (Q).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
